About 7 Borough Street
7 Borough Street is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Kegworth, Derby, Derby (DE74 2FF). It has a recorded floor area of 77 m² (around 829 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band B. Tenure is freehold. The latest certificate (March 2020)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. When first surveyed in September 2008 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Average and h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Good; while lighting dropped from Good to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 82), a 2-band jump.
Sold June 2021 for £164,000.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end. Across 1997–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.3%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£205,000 is 25%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£198/sq ft) was about 34.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 77 m² it's 20.6%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(97 m² median across 27 EPCs).
